About Joaquı́n Madrenas
Joaquı́n Madrenas is a scholar working on Immunology, Molecular Biology, Oncology, Infectious Diseases and Epidemiology, having authored 105 papers that have together received 4.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include T-cell and B-cell Immunology (39 papers), Immune Cell Function and Interaction (33 papers), Immune Response and Inflammation (19 papers),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(9 papers), Antimicrobial Resistance in Staphylococcus (8 papers), CAR-T cell therapy research (8 papers), Monoclonal and Polyclonal Antibodies Research (7 papers) and Mitochondrial Function and Pathology (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Immunology (2.3k citations), Oncology (723 citations), Immunology and Allergy (116 citations), Molecular Biology (1.3k citations) and Infectious Diseases (325 citations). Joaquı́n Madrenas has collaborated with scholars based in Canada, United States and France. Frequent co-authors include Mark G. Kirchhof, Wendy A. Teft, Luan A. Chau, Ronald N. Germain, Miren L. Baroja, Ronald L. Wange, Thu Chau, Lawrence E. Samelson, Noah Isakov and Jeffrey A. Bluestone. Their work appears in journals such as The Journal of Immunology, PLoS ONE, European Journal of Immunology, Journal of Leukocyte Biology and Molecular and Cellular Biology.
